打造极致体验:超级手机游戏系统的设计与实现

随着智能手机的普及和游戏产业的快速发展,手机游戏已经成为人们日常生活中不可或缺的一部分。一款优秀的手机游戏系统,不仅需要具备丰富的游戏内容,更需要提供极致的用户体验。本文将探讨超级手机游戏系统的设计与实现,旨在为游戏开发者提供有益的参考。
一、系统概述

超级手机游戏系统是指一套集成了游戏开发、运营、推广、数据分析等功能的综合性平台。该系统旨在为用户提供全方位的游戏体验,同时为开发者提供便捷的开发工具和运营支持。
二、系统架构

超级手机游戏系统采用分层架构,主要包括以下几层:
表现层:负责用户界面展示,包括游戏画面、音效、动画等。
业务逻辑层:负责游戏规则、数据处理、用户交互等核心功能。
数据访问层:负责与数据库进行交互,实现数据存储和查询。
服务层:提供游戏运营、推广、数据分析等服务。
三、关键技术

超级手机游戏系统涉及多项关键技术,以下列举几个关键点:
游戏引擎:采用高性能的游戏引擎,如Unity3D、Cocos2d-x等,实现游戏画面和音效的渲染。
网络通信:采用WebSocket、HTTP等协议,实现客户端与服务器之间的实时通信。
数据库技术:采用MySQL、MongoDB等数据库,实现游戏数据的存储和查询。
数据分析:利用大数据技术,对用户行为、游戏数据进行分析,为游戏运营提供决策依据。
四、系统功能

超级手机游戏系统具备以下功能:
游戏开发:提供丰富的游戏开发工具,支持2D、3D游戏开发。
用户管理:实现用户注册、登录、权限管理等功能。
游戏运营:支持游戏版本更新、活动策划、数据分析等运营工作。
推广营销:提供多种推广渠道,助力游戏快速传播。
数据分析:实时监控游戏数据,为游戏优化提供依据。
五、系统优势

超级手机游戏系统具有以下优势:
高性能:采用高性能的游戏引擎和数据库,确保游戏流畅运行。
易用性:提供简洁易用的操作界面,降低开发者学习成本。
可扩展性:支持多种游戏类型和功能扩展,满足不同需求。
安全性:采用多种安全措施,保障用户数据和游戏安全。
超级手机游戏系统是一款集游戏开发、运营、推广、数据分析于一体的综合性平台。通过采用先进的技术和丰富的功能,为用户提供极致的游戏体验,助力游戏开发者实现商业价值。随着手机游戏产业的不断发展,超级手机游戏系统将在未来发挥越来越重要的作用。